- Модуль: catalog
- Путь к файлу: ~/bitrix/modules/catalog/lib/productcompilationtable.php
- Класс: BitrixCatalogProductCompilationTable
- Вызов: ProductCompilationTable::getMap
static function getMap()
{
return [
new IntegerField(
'ID',
[
'primary' => true,
'autocomplete' => true,
'title' => Loc::getMessage('PRODUCT_COMPILATION_ENTITY_ID_FIELD')
]
),
new IntegerField(
'DEAL_ID',
[
'required' => true,
'title' => Loc::getMessage('PRODUCT_COMPILATION_ENTITY_DEAL_ID_FIELD')
]
),
new TextField(
'PRODUCT_IDS',
[
'required' => true,
'title' => Loc::getMessage('PRODUCT_COMPILATION_ENTITY_PRODUCT_IDS_FIELD')
]
),
new DatetimeField(
'CREATION_DATE',
[
'required' => true,
'title' => Loc::getMessage('PRODUCT_COMPILATION_ENTITY_PRODUCT_IDS_FIELD')
]
),
new IntegerField(
'CHAT_ID',
[
'required' => false,
'title' => Loc::getMessage('PRODUCT_COMPILATION_ENTITY_CHAT_ID_FIELD')
]
),
new IntegerField(
'QUEUE_ID',
[
'required' => false,
'title' => Loc::getMessage('PRODUCT_COMPILATION_ENTITY_QUEUE_ID_FIELD')
]
),
];
}